CORRAN HARRINGTON is the 2017 Benjamin Franklin Gold Winner for Best New Voice: Fiction (Independent Book Publishers Association - IBPA) for Follow the River Home. The book was also a 2016 Finalist in the New Mexico-Arizona Book Awards in categories for Fiction, First Book NM, and Cover. Harrington is also a Pushcart Prize nominee, a Bosque Fiction Contest finalist, and a New Millennium Writings Award semifinalist. Follow the River Home, published by Arbor Farm Press (April 2016), was a Hidden River Arts international writing competition finalist, and a 2013 Santa Fe Writers Project fiction finalist. Corran Harrington I don’t give writer’s block much attention. Like most writers, I have times where I am less than prolific. I trust that I will write when I am moved to write. If I am working under a publisher’s deadline, though, I am very disciplined and just make myself sit down and start the process. A writer has to be willing to write poorly, if that is what it takes to get something onto the page. Poor writing can usually be redeemed and made good; that’s where craft comes into play. (less)
